What Is Tarot? A Friendly Primer on Cards, Decks, and Meaning

What began as Renaissance playing cards evolved into a tool for meaning, meditation, and insight. Surviving decks from Renaissance Italy and later revivals in the 1910s and the 1970s shaped the modern practice.

tarot cards

From historical roots to present use

Recorded origins trace to the Middle Ages and to Renaissance Italy. Over the years the system grew into a resource for healing, reflection, and divination.

Major Arcana and Minor Arcana

A 78-piece structure divides into 22 Major Arcana that map big life cycles and 56 Minor Arcana that explore everyday themes. The Minor use four suits—cups, pentacles, wands, and swords—to show practical patterns.

Choosing a deck and learning resources

The Rider‑Waite‑Smith deck (1910) remains influential and appears in many books and study guides. Different art and symbols can make a deck feel personal, so pick one that resonates. If you want a deeper look, visit our tarot resource page for starter suggestions.
